Prevention of significant deterioration Set II. a regulatory analysis

Section 116 of the Clean Air Act, as amended, requires the EPA to promulgate regulations for the prevention of significant deterioration (PSD) of air quality regarding hydrocarbons, carbon monoxide, ozone, nitrogen oxides, and lead (Set II pollutants). This program will affect industry siting, particularly in rural, undeveloped areas. Among the alternatives currently being considered by EPA to meet the PSD Set II goals are emission management systems, marketable emission permits, air quality increments, emission fees, and control of transportation related sources. The final regulation may be a combination of several options or may present several alternatives from which a state would choose its specific program. EPA has formed an interagency work group to insure that the PSD Set II regulation is consistent with other agencies' policies as well as existing EPA programs. Public participation will be encouraged throughout this regulatory development.
